About the Role

IAG Cargo is seeking a motivated individual to plan and deliver transformational projects, ensuring high-quality outcomes within scope, time, and budget. This role involves proactive risk management, stakeholder collaboration, and embedding change within the organization.

Responsibilities

  • Plan and deliver transformational projects in alignment with internal controls, financial guidelines, and organizational priorities.
  • Ensure high-quality project delivery within scope, time, and budget.
  • Proactively identify and manage risks, issues, dependencies, and opportunities.
  • Use analysis and strong relationship-building skills to mitigate challenges and maximise success.
  • Gather, analyse, and integrate proposals from multiple suppliers and stakeholders.
  • Provide well-informed recommendations that drive optimal solutions and meet project objectives.
  • Develop and manage comprehensive project plans outlining critical paths, risks, efficiencies, and opportunities for simplification or acceleration.
  • Ensure project plans align with business goals.
  • Maintain rigorous change management processes, facilitating trade-offs and adjustments as needed.
  • Balance project constraints and priorities.
  • Collaborate on resource planning and allocation, working closely with resource owners.
  • Optimise the use of skills and capabilities across the organisation.
  • Deliver clear and consistent communication to stakeholders at all levels.
  • Ensure alignment, transparency, and buy-in throughout the project lifecycle.
  • Build and maintain strong relationships with suppliers and internal stakeholders.
  • Hold parties accountable for performance and ensure project milestones are met.
  • Embed change into the organisation by creating and executing effective business change plans.
  • Minimise disruption and enhance adoption of changes.
  • Adhere to standardised project management principles, tools, and techniques.
  • Contribute to continuous improvement in delivery methods and outcomes.

About the Company

  • IAG Cargo is one of the world’s largest airfreight logistics organisations.
  • We move cargo that positively impacts society worldwide.
  • We are the logistics and cargo brand of International Airlines Group (Aer Lingus, British Airways, Iberia, Level and Vueling).
  • Our reach is truly global.
